CORDELE, GA- Trae Sims, a concerned citizen addressed the Cordele City Commission Tuesday night.
“Mr. Deriso has violated multiple sections of Georgia Title 45. Dude, I got facts out the rear end. You want facts? Let’s get facts,” said Sims.
Sims attempted to present what he alleges are facts regarding decisions made by Chairman Deriso since taking office.
Chairman Deriso would have Sims escorted out after the two got into a tense exchange.
“Use your 5 minutes to speak on that or you are not going to speak against me, or you will be removed,” said Deriso
“Come down here and remove me then,” said Sims.
Deriso cites city policy in his decision to have Sims removed from Tuesday’s meeting.
“First one, no person shall be allowed to make obscene, derogatory, or slanderous remarks that disrupt the orderly conduct of the meeting. Second one, no person shall disrupt or interfere in anyway with the conduct of the meeting,” said Josh Deriso, Cordele City Chairman.
Deriso says because Smith violated city policy that was grounds for his removal.
